Young People's Concert

Reggae Roots

Sun, Apr 16, 2023 Roy Thomson Hall

Explore the evolution of Jamaica’s most famous export, and discover the people, sounds, and stories of the musical movement that grew to influence music around the globe. Jamaican-born, Halifax-based vocalist Jah’Mila finds her groove with Barrett Principal Education Conductor and Community Ambassador Daniel Bartholomew-Poyser and the TSO in a program that reflects on the social, cultural, and spiritual importance of the magical musical genre that has shaped Jamaica and touched the world.

Plus, join us for pre-concert lobby activities included in the price of your ticket. Coming to us all the way from The Rose Brampton, we have a special performance by the multi-talented youth orchestra, the Rosebuds!

This concert is also offered as a Relaxed Performance. For more information, visit the Reggae Roots Relaxed Performance page.
